What are Transgender Mouse Studies?
Transgender mouse studies are a specific type of animal research focusing on the effects of hormones and sex differentiation. These studies utilize animal models to investigate complex biological processes related to sex development and hormonal manipulation, offering insights that may be applicable to human health. The research isn't about creating transgender mice, but rather using them to understand fundamental biological mechanisms. This research aims to provide a better understanding of the intricate interplay of genetic, hormonal, and environmental factors influencing sex characteristics and development. This knowledge is crucial for advancing our understanding of various human health conditions.
- Types of studies: These studies might involve manipulating hormone levels in mice to observe the impact on their development and physiology, mimicking, in a simplified way, certain aspects of hormonal therapies used in humans. Other studies may focus on the genetic components of sex differentiation.
- Potential benefits: Research on transgender mouse models contributes to a better understanding of reproductive health, infertility, and the effectiveness and side effects of hormonal therapies. This research has implications for improving the care of transgender individuals and advancing broader biological knowledge.
- Limitations and ethical considerations: Like all animal research, this type of study requires careful ethical review and adherence to strict guidelines. The limitations include the inherent differences between mice and humans, meaning that results may not always directly translate to humans. Ethical concerns regarding the use of animals in research are always paramount and carefully considered.
Tracing the Funding
Identifying Funding Sources
Scientific research in the US relies heavily on government grants, particularly from the National Institutes of Health (NIH). The NIH funds a broad range of research, including studies on various aspects of human health and biology. To determine if taxpayer money funds transgender mouse studies, we must examine NIH grant databases and other relevant funding sources.
- Grant application process: The NIH's grant application process is rigorous, involving peer review by experts in the field to assess the scientific merit and feasibility of proposed research projects. This peer review system aims to ensure that only high-quality, impactful research receives funding.
- Transparency of grant information: The NIH maintains publicly accessible databases detailing awarded grants, including the research project's title, principal investigator, and funding amount. Ethical Considerations and Future Directions
Ethical Implications of Animal Research
Ethical considerations are paramount in animal research, including studies using mice. The "3Rs" – Replacement, Reduction, and Refinement – are guiding principles. Replacement aims to find alternatives to animal use whenever possible; Reduction focuses on minimizing the number of animals used; and Refinement seeks to minimize any potential suffering or distress experienced by the animals.
- Regulation of animal research: Animal research is strictly regulated in the US and elsewhere. Researchers must obtain ethical approval from Institutional Animal Care and Use Committees (IACUCs), which review research proposals to ensure humane treatment of animals and adherence to ethical guidelines.
- Future research: Future research in this area may focus on developing more sophisticated and humane animal models, potentially incorporating advanced technologies such as CRISPR gene editing or organ-on-a-chip technology to reduce the need for traditional animal studies.
- Alternative research methods: Scientists continuously explore alternatives to animal research, such as in vitro studies using human cells and tissues, computer modeling, and advanced imaging techniques. These alternatives hold the potential to reduce or eventually eliminate the need for animal models in some areas of research.
